<a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/">Kia</a>, DC Entertainment and <em>Super Street</em> magazine worked as a team to develop this one-of-a-kind Superman-themed <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/optima+hybrid/">Optima Hybrid</a> that made its debut at the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/chicago-auto-show/">Chicago Auto Show</a> today. The joint effort is designed to raise awareness for DC Entertainment's "<a href="http://www.wecanbeheroes.org/">We Can Be Heroes</a>" campaign, a charitable relief effort to bring help and hope to people affected by drought and famine in the Horn of Africa.<br />
<br />
The metallic blue and red sedan, which thankfully manages to look better in person than it does in the pictures, is the seventh vehicle in a 10-month partnership between the automaker, comic book company and tuner as they build themed vehicles representing all of the Justice League heros. A yet-unseen eighth vehicle will be an amalgamation of all seven Super Heroes in one.<br />
<br />
There is no mistaking the blue metallic finish with red chrome accents, or the world's most recognizable superhero's chest emblem glowing on the hood, but you have to look closer to see the Superman logo on the rear fascia and catch the red glow from the headlights. The theme has been carried into the cabin, where occupants will find custom upholstery and Superman's iconic shield on the seats and airbag cover. While the hybrid sedan's gasoline-electric powertrain remains untouched, the Optima features flared fenders, oversize 22-inch wheels and a height-adjustable suspension that is controlled from the cockpit. The Justice League of America's garage is filling up quickly, with <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/">Kia</a> and DC Entertainment unveiling its sixth of eight super hero-inspired vehicles at the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/chicago-auto-show/">Chicago Auto Show</a> today. The vehicles are being used to raise awareness for DC Entertainment's "<a href="http://www.wecanbeheroes.org/">We Can Be Heroes</a>" giving campaign.<br />
<br />
The latest Kia to get the super hero treatment is the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/optima+hybrid/">Optima Hybrid</a>, which draws on the almighty <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/tag/superman/">Superman</a> for inspiration. We mentioned this is the sixth of eight super-hero inspired Kias. The first five were <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2012/10/11/batman-inspired-kia-optima-concept-headed-for-gotham-reveal/">Batman (Optima SX)</a>, <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/kia-justice-league-inspired-custom-cars-sema-2012/#photo-5398967/">Flash (Forte Koup)</a>, <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/kia-justice-league-inspired-custom-cars-sema-2012/#photo-5398952/">Green Lanter (Soul)</a>, <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/kia-justice-league-inspired-custom-cars-sema-2012/#photo-5398962/">Cyborg (Forte Five-Door)</a> and <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/photos/kia-justice-league-inspired-custom-cars-sema-2012/#photo-5398973/">Aquaman (Rio Five-door)</a>. That means the seventh car will be for Wonder Woman, and we can't wait to see how tastefully her costume can be converted into a car design. <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/">Kia</a> is teaming up with the Justice League once again to create another show car that will be on display at the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/chicago-auto-show/">Chicago Auto Show</a>. At the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2012/10/30/kia-justice-league-cars-sema-2012/">2012 SEMA Show</a>, Kia showed off various models inspired by DC Entertainment characters Batman, Aquaman, Flash, Green Lantern and Cyborg, but a Superman-themed <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/optima+hybrid/">Kia Optima Hybrid</a> will roll into the Windy City for next week's show.<br />
<br />
In the above drawing, we only get to see a small portion of this car inspired by the Man of Steel, but it will have the requisite red-and-blue paint scheme with Superman's shield on the hood (subtle, it is not).<br />
<br />
The previous cars include the Batman <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/optima/">Optima</a>, Aquaman <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/rio/">Rio</a>, Flash <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/forte+koup/">Forte Koup</a>, Green Lantern <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/soul/">Soul</a> and Cyborg <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/forte/">Forte</a>. 	We're capturing our first driving impressions of the <a href="http://autoblog.com/tag/optima+hybrid">2011 Kia Optima Hybrid</a> this week, but we've already learned that the midsize fuel-sipper will be priced at $26,500 when it goes on sale in the coming months, excluding $750 for destination and handling.<br />
	<br />
	Curiously, the $26,500 price tag represents an increase of $705 versus the <a href="http://autoblog.com/kia/optima">Optima</a>'s platform mate, the <a href="http://autoblog.com/hyundai/sonata+hybrid">2011 Hyundai Sonata Hybrid</a>. <a href="http://autoblog.com/make/kia">Kia</a> tells us that the price increase is because the Optima comes with more standard equipment than the <a href="http://autoblog.com/hyundai/sonata">Sonata</a>, including things like a rear backup camera, rear spoiler, auto-down front windows for the driver and passenger, a cooling glovebox, compass, and <a href="http://autoblog.com/tag/uvo">Uvo</a>, Kia's brand new infotainment system.</div><p style="padding:5px;background:#ddd;border:1px solid #ccc;clear:both;"><a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2011/05/10/2011-kia-optima-hybrid-priced-from-26-500/">2011 Kia Optima Hybrid priced from $26,500*</a> originally appeared on <a href="http://www.autoblog.com">Autoblog</a> on Tue, 10 May 2011 17:26:00 EST. The <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/hyundai/sonata+hybrid">Hyundai Sonata Hybrid</a> was supposed to go on sale in December, but at the eleventh hour, the company decided on a last-minute engineering change to enhance safety. When the automaker learned that President Obama planned to sign a bill that would ban a switch that can disable a noisemaker designed to warn blind pedestrians, the Korean automaker decided it was best to remove the switch. The move delayed mass availability of the Sonata Hybrid from December to late April.<br />
<br />
But what about its twin, the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/optima">Kia Optima Hybrid</a>? <em>Ward's Automotive</em> reports that the mid-size hybrid has been delayed until late in the second quarter, or about five months after its scheduled January launch.<br />
<br />
Will the substantial delay of the Optima and Sonata Hybrids hurt sales and satisfaction? We're sure there are probably some impatient buyers out there who don't understand why they have to wait, but in the long run, we're likely looking at a mere bump in the road.<br />

<a href="http://autoblog.com/model/kia">Kia</a> is just now beginning to roll out its sexy new <a href="http://autoblog.com/kia/optima">2011 Optima</a>, with the 2.4-liter GDI version <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2010/11/17/2011-kia-optima-officially-priced-from-18-995/">priced from only $18,995</a>. Much like its sister car, the <a href="http://autoblog.com/hyundai/sonata">Hyundai Sonata</a>, the Optima will be offered with a turbocharged 2.0-liter engine in EX and SX trims, and here at the <a href="http://autoblog.com/la-auto-show">LA Auto Show</a>, the Kia has unveiled its third member of the Optima family - the Hybrid.<br />
<br />
Much like the Sonata Hybrid, the gas/electric Optima uses the same 2.4-liter direct-injected inline-four, mated to an electric motor. Combined with a six-speed automatic transmission, the Optima Hybrid will yield 40 miles per gallon on the highway - besting its eco-minded competitors, the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2009/08/19/review-2010-ford-fusion-hybrid-what-a-difference-60-degrees-m/">Ford Fusion Hybrid</a> and Toyota Camry Hybrid.<br />

We're still trying to stay on top of everything being officially unveiled next week at the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/paris-motor-show/">Paris Motor Show</a>, but it looks like we may also need to keep an eye trained on the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/la-auto-show/">LA Auto Show</a> as well. Auto Guide is reporting that <a href="http://autoblog.com/make/kia/">Kia</a> will officially unveil the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/kia/optima">Optima</a> Hybrid on the left coast, giving <a href="http://autoblog.com/make/hyundai/">Hyundai's</a> smaller sibling an entry in the battery-assisted market. <br />
<br />
The Optima Hybrid is sure to be powered by the very same 169-horsepower 2.4-liter Theta II engine mated to a 30 kW electric motor that thriftily motivates the <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2010/07/19/2011-hyundai-sonata-hybrid-first-drive-review-road-test/">Sonata Hybrid</a>. If that is indeed the case, we expect the same impressive fuel economy figures of 39 miles per gallon around town and 37 mpg on the highway, along with an electric-only top speed of 62 miles per hour. <br />
<br />
With a hybrid variant set to join the naturally aspirated 2.4-liter base model and the 274 horsepower <a href="http://www.autoblog.com/2010/03/31/2011-hyundai-sonata-turbo-new-york-2010/">2.0-liter turbo variant</a>, the Optima looks to be quite the upstart in the always competitive midsized sedan segment. The Optima Hybrid will reportedly go on sale early in 2011.<br />
